Locus Dispatcher vs Route4Me vs Uber for Business — at a glance
| Feature | Locus Dispatcher | Route4Me | Uber for Business |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rating | — | 4.0 / 5 | — |
| Reviews | — | 364 | — |
| Starting price | Contact for pricing | $60 /user/month | Contact for pricing |
| Free trial | No | Yes | Yes |
| Free version | No | No | No |
| Best for | Large Enterprises, Medium Business, Small Business | Large Enterprises, Medium Business, Small Business | Large Enterprises, Medium Business, Small Business |
| Category | Route Planning Software | Route Planning Software | Travel Management Software |
| Platforms | SaaS/Web/Cloud, Installed - Windows | SaaS/Web/Cloud, Mobile - Android, Mobile - iOS, Installed - Windows, Installed - Mac | SaaS/Web/Cloud, Mobile - Android, Mobile - iOS |
| API | — | Available | — |
| Support modes | 24/7 (Live rep), Online | 24/7 (Live rep), Business Hours, Online | Online |
| Certifications | — | — | SOC 2 |
| Data residency | US | Global | Global |
Key differences between Locus Dispatcher and Route4Me
- Pricing: Route4Me starts at $60 /user/month. Locus Dispatcher pricing is not publicly listed.
- Free trial: Route4Me offers a free trial; Locus Dispatcher does not.
- Deployment: Locus Dispatcher sup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Installed - Windows; Route4Me sup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Mobile - Android, Mobile - iOS, Installed - Windows, Installed - Mac.

Frequently asked questions
- Which is better, Locus Dispatcher or Route4Me?
- Route4Me edges out the other on user ratings (4.0 vs -1.0). That said, the best pick depends on your use case — use the comparison tables above to evaluate each dimension.
- Do Locus Dispatcher and Route4Me offer a free trial?
- Route4Me offers a free trial. Locus Dispatcher does not.
- What is the starting price of Locus Dispatcher vs Route4Me?
- Locus Dispatcher starts at Contact for pricing. Route4Me starts at $60 /user/month.
